my stop loss is generally at about 5 BI per session. At that point i usually at least take a break and make sure i am playing ok quickly, by reviewing key hands.

obv as many of you know, i have thrown this stop loss idea out the window before, but its really easy to follow it when you arent running poorly.

If i lose more then 4-5 i start to feel very frustrated and then you just gotta quit. Those guys with huge losing days probably tilted away alot, missed alot of value and called bets they shouldnt. So its burning money if you keep playing.

Allthough i once had a -9bi day, from then on I pretty much started using the stoploss thing.
